Ex-Strictly star 'jealous' of Walsh

Chelsee Healey said she would be jealous watching Pasha Kovalev dance with his new partner Kimberley Walsh
Former Strictly Come Dancing contestant Chelsee Healey is "jealous" of Girls Aloud star Kimberley Walsh dancing with her partner from last year's series.
The actress, who was runner-up with professional dancer Pasha Kovalev, said she is going to have trouble watching the pair perform together.
Still keeping fit after her stint on the dance show, Chelsee, who took part in the Virgin Active London Triathlon, said she is unsure if she will be able to tune in for the BBC One show but said she will definitely support Kimberley and Pasha.
"I don't know because I'm so upset that I'm not doing it, so I'm going to find it quite hard to watch.
"Obviously I'll support them. To be honest I was a bit jealous but I think they'll be amazing. He's got lucky," she said.
The 24-year-old Waterloo Road star was unwilling to enter the debate sparked by Chris Evans about whether contestant Denise Van Outen is at an advantage due to her musical theatre background, saying only: "I'll wait and see what she's like on the dancefloor before I pass comment."
However, Chelsee was keen to offer advice to the female contestants about the show's famous revealing costumes after a 'wardrobe malfunction' left her red-faced during one of her dances last year.
Her tip to anyone who suffers the same embarrassment this year is "just to crack on" as "it's not the end of the world".
She said: "Don't go too low, but also wear what you feel comfortable in and what you can dance in."
A total of 14 celebrities are taking part in the latest series of the dance show including Olympic champion Victoria Pendleton, model Jerry Hall and gymnast Louis Smith.
